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ian has ordered the start of nuclear talks with the United States, local media said on Monday (February 2, 2026), after U.S. leader Donald Trump said he was hopeful of a deal to avert military action against the Islamic republic.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ian has ordered the start of nuclear talks with the United States, local media said on Monday, after U.S. President Donald Trump said he was hopeful of a deal to avert military action against the Islamic republic.Following the Iranian authorities’ deadly response to anti-government protests that peaked last month, Mr. Trump has threatened military action and ordered the dispatch of an aircraft carrier group to West Asia.“President Pezeshkian has ordered the opening of talks with the United States,” the news agency Fars reported on Monday. “Iran and the United States will hold talks on the nuclear file,” Fars said, without specifying a date.Iran said earlier on Monday it was working on a method and framework for negotiations that would be ready in the coming days.
